Rob wrote:
I have a Windows 2003 AD and I am trying to force a minimum of 8 character
passwords at the next password change via a GPO named Security. Security is
linked to the domain and it is #1 in the link order. I am using an XP client
as my test system. I can see via Group Policy Results that this GPO and the
8 character limit are being applied to this PC but the user is still able to
change the password to something less than 8 characters. Any ideas on what I
missed?
